This 10-minute morning meditation helps you begin the day with calm focus and renewed energy. Through gentle breath awareness, a guided body scan, and soothing visualization, you are invited to release tension and ground yourself in the present moment. Affirmations support a mindset of clarity, trust, and openness, allowing you to carry peace and radiant energy into your day.

Transcript

Welcome to this morning meditation practice.

This is Natalie and I am honored to guide you.

This practice will help you arrive fully in the present moment.

Release any tension from sleep and gently shift your mind and body into a calm,

Focused and open state so you can move into your day with clarity,

Peace and energy.

Take a moment to settle in.

Sit upright but relaxed,

Shoulders soft,

Hands resting gently on your lap or knees.

Close your eyes if that feels safe or keep them softly open with a downward gaze.

Begin by simply noticing your breath.

Feel the natural rhythm,

The gentle rising and falling of your chest and belly.

Notice the cold air rushing into your nostrils and the warm air exiting the nostrils.

Simply notice.

Now let's deepen the breath slightly.

Inhale through your nose to the count of four.

One,

Two,

Three,

Four.

Hold for two.

One,

Two.

Exhale slowly through the mouth to the count of six.

One,

Two,

Three,

Four,

Five,

Six.

Repeat this for several cycles.

Inhale two,

Three,

Four.

Hold two.

Exhale two,

Three,

Four,

Five,

Six.

Inhale two,

Three,

Four.

Hold two.

Exhale two,

Three,

Four,

Five,

Six.

Continue to breathe in this cycle and with every exhale feel your body letting go of any leftover heaviness from the night.

Each breath is an invitation to relax a little deeper and to create inner spaciousness for the day ahead.

Now I'll guide you through your body part by part.

As I name each area,

Gently bring your awareness there.

Simply notice how it feels and then invite just a little more relaxation into that space.

Bring awareness to the crown of your head.

Soften your scalp,

Your forehead,

Your eyebrows,

Your eyes.

Feel your jaw unclench.

Your tongue rests softly.

Notice your neck and shoulders.

With each exhale let them drop away from your ears.

Move down into your arms,

Your hands,

Your fingers.

Invite them to feel heavy,

Relaxed,

Supported.

Bring awareness to your chest,

Noticing the gentle rise and fall with each breath.

Feel your belly soften.

If there is any tightness,

Imagine it melting with the next exhale.

Notice your back.

Allow it to lengthen and open.

Now bring your attention to your hips,

Your thighs,

Your knees.

Let them grow heavy,

Sinking into support.

Feel your calves,

Your ankles,

Your feet and imagine the soles of your feet connecting to the ground beneath you.

Take one deep breath,

Feeling your whole body connected,

Relaxed and present.

Now imagine a warm golden light at the center of your chest.

With each inhale this light grows brighter,

Filling your whole body with warmth and energy.

With each exhale it expands beyond you into the space around you.

Inhale,

This light grows brighter,

Filling your body.

Exhale,

It expands beyond you.

See this light as your inner energy,

Your unique presence as it radiates.

Silently repeat these affirmations or let my words wash over you.

I am calm,

Clear and open to what this wonderful day brings.

I trust myself to handle today with ease and grace.

I welcome opportunities,

Joy and connection.

I am grounded in peace and I carry it with me.

Breathe in,

Letting these words settle deep into your being and exhale feeling them anchor in your body.

Take a final deep breath,

Filling your lungs completely.

Hold for a moment and exhale releasing fully.

Begin to bring small movements back into your body.

Wiggle your fingers and toes,

Roll your shoulders gently,

Maybe smile softly to yourself.

And when you're ready,

Open your eyes.

Carry this sense of calm,

Clarity and radiant energy with you into your day.

This practice is always here for you whenever you want to return to yourself.
